Driver Grade II – Mtwara Urban Water Supply & Sanitation Authority

Key Duties and Responsibilities
• Driving properly any type of vehicle assigned to him/her.
• Ensuring that the vehicle assigned is always clean, in good running
condition and is parked in a safe place.
• Reporting promptly any detected fault or defect on the motor vehicle.
• Certifying that the repairs/maintenance carried out on the vehicle is
of adequate standard.
• Sending the vehicle for service when due and advice on fuel
consumption rates.
• Using the vehicles only on assigned duties and to keep time when on duty.
• Ensuring that the security of vehicles is safeguarded all the time.
• Maintaining vehicle’ logbook accurately and timely recorded.

Minimum Required Qualifications and Experience
• Holder of Form IV / VI certificate
• Driving License class C and Training from NIT,
• Trade Test level Two in Motor vehicle driving and not coursed accident
in three years consecutively
• Age limits: Not above 45 years old
• Work Experience of Not less than three (3) years proven working
experience in similar position
